服务器监听 什么意思?

37秒前 924阅读
服务器监听是指服务器通过特定的端口,等待并接收客户端发出的连接请求,当客户端发起连接请求时,服务器会响应这些请求并建立连接,以便进行数据通信,监听是服务器实现通信功能的重要一环,确保服务器能够实时接收并处理来自客户端的请求。

服务器监听深度解析

随着互联网技术的飞速发展,服务器作为网络的核心组件之一,其功能和作用愈发重要,服务器监听是服务器功能中的关键环节,对于服务器的正常运行和网络服务的提供至关重要,本文将深度解析服务器监听的含义、原理、应用场景、重要性以及实际操作中的注意事项。

服务器监听 什么意思?

服务器监听的含义

服务器监听是指服务器通过网络端口等待并接收客户端的连接请求,当服务器启动后,它会创建一个或多个套接字(Socket),并绑定到一个特定的端口上,这些端口就像是通向特定服务的门户,客户端可以通过这些端口与服务器建立连接,并发送请求或接收响应,服务器通过监听这些端口,实时捕获客户端的连接请求,并根据请求的内容做出相应的响应。

服务器监听的工作原理

服务器监听的工作原理可以分为三个主要步骤:创建套接字、绑定端口和监听连接请求。

服务器监听 什么意思?

  1. 创建套接字:服务器在启动后,首先创建一个或多个套接字,这些套接字是网络通信的端点,允许服务器与其他设备进行通信。
  2. 绑定端口:服务器将创建的套接字绑定到一个特定的网络端口上,每个端口都有一个特定的编号,对应一种特定的网络服务。
  3. 监听连接请求:服务器通过绑定的端口开始监听来自客户端的连接请求,当客户端发起连接请求时,服务器会捕获这个请求,并建立与客户端的通信通道,以便进行数据传输。

服务器监听的应用场景

服务器监听广泛应用于各种网络服务场景,如Web服务器、邮件服务器、数据库服务器和游戏服务器等。

  1. Web服务器:Web服务器通过监听80或443端口,接收来自浏览器的HTTP请求,并返回相应的网页内容。
  2. 邮件服务器:邮件服务器通过监听SMTP、POP3等协议的端口,接收和发送电子邮件。
  3. 数据库服务器:数据库服务器负责管理和存储大量的数据,它通过监听特定的端口,允许客户端连接并访问数据库。
  4. 游戏服务器:在线游戏需要实时的数据交换,游戏服务器通过监听特定的端口,接收并处理来自游戏客户端的数据请求。

服务器监听的重要性

服务器监听是服务器能够提供服务的基础,没有监听,服务器就无法捕获来自客户端的请求,也就无法提供相应的服务,无论是Web服务、邮件服务、数据库服务还是游戏服务,都离不开服务器监听的支持,对于任何提供网络服务的系统来说,服务器监听都是至关重要的。

服务器监听 什么意思?

实际操作中的注意事项

在实际操作中,需要注意以下几点:

  1. 选择合适的端口:不同的服务需要使用不同的端口,确保选择的端口没有被其他服务占用,并且符合相关标准和规范。
  2. 安全性:确保服务器监听的端口不会被恶意攻击和入侵,可以采取一些安全措施,如使用防火墙、限制访问权限等。
  3. 性能优化:确保服务器监听的性能良好,能够处理大量的并发请求,可以采取一些性能优化措施,如使用高性能的硬件、优化网络配置等。

服务器监听是服务器通过网络端口等待并接收客户端连接请求的过程,它是服务器能够提供服务的基础,通过深入了解服务器监听的原理、应用场景和注意事项,我们可以更好地利用服务器,满足不断增长的网络需求。

VPS购买请点击我

免责声明:我们致力于保护作者版权,注重分享,被刊用文章因无法核实真实出处,未能及时与作者取得联系,或有版权异议的,请联系管理员,我们会立即处理! 部分文章是来自自研大数据AI进行生成,内容摘自(百度百科,百度知道,头条百科,中国民法典,刑法,牛津词典,新华词典,汉语词典,国家院校,科普平台)等数据,内容仅供学习参考,不准确地方联系删除处理! 图片声明:本站部分配图来自人工智能系统AI生成,觅知网授权图片,PxHere摄影无版权图库和百度,360,搜狗等多加搜索引擎自动关键词搜索配图,如有侵权的图片,请第一时间联系我们,邮箱:ciyunidc@ciyunshuju.com。本站只作为美观性配图使用,无任何非法侵犯第三方意图,一切解释权归图片著作权方,本站不承担任何责任。如有恶意碰瓷者,必当奉陪到底严惩不贷!

目录[+]